SemiAnalysis:
A detailed look at the Apple-TSMC relationship: Apple's annual spend at TSMC rose 12x, from $2B in 2014 to $24B in 2025, and once made up 25% of TSMC's revenue  —  Wafer Demand Model, Node Economics, and the shifting power dynamics as AI reshapes the foundry landscape
Toby Nangle / Financial Times:
Analysis: the AI investment boom represents ~1% of US GDP, roughly half the GDP share during the '90s dot-com boom and comparable to the mid-2010s US shale boom  —  US economist Jason Furman caused a bit of a kerfuffle in 2025 when he estimated that investment in information processing equipment & software …

Anil Dash:
A look at the history and rise of Markdown, which has been adopted across the tech industry in the decades since its quiet launch in 2004 by John Gruber  —  Nearly every bit of the high-tech world, from the most cutting-edge AI systems at the biggest companies, to the casual scraps …
